Hi Gurus,

Is there any chance of knowing whether the user created and assigned to organization structure is involved in workflow or not..

If yes how can I know that particular person is there and participating in workflow as approver.

Basically when you enter some information on the shopping cart and hit enter, you will have the approvers list on the approval process overview tab, but without this, by visiting organization structure and opening that user can we know whether the person is involved in workflow.

Hi,

Approver determination based on your logic. Still generic way is:

1. Find out all positions from PPOMA which has tagging M or B-012 relation ship. From HRP1001 tables

Remove those positions from above list which shopping cart creator positions are not linked

2. Add the purchaser list if maitained separately.
